LEADING MANUFACTURERS AND MERCHANTS CITY OF BROOKLYN Theo. F. SMITH

Manufacturer of Fine Confectionery, Ice-Cream, etc. Dealer in Toys, Fancy Goods, etc. No. 17 Main Street, Flushing.- This house was founded forty years ago by Mr. Caleb Smith, who in 1885 took into partnership his son, Mr. Then. F. Smith. In the spring of 1886 the founder died, and since then the business has been conducted by the son, who was bred and reared in the business. The house is the oldest one in its line in Flushing, and the proprietor is the descendant of one of the oldest families in the town. The premises comprise a store 30x 125 feet in dimensions, and this embraces a neatly fitted up sales-room and a handsomely furnished ice-cream saloon. Mr. Smith manufactures all his own confectionery, ice-cream, water ices, French and Italian cream, Charlotte de Russe, jellies, etc., and families and parties are supplied with these delicacies on the shortest notice and at the most reasonable prices.
